Microsoft's Culture of Innovation: An Interview with CIO Tony Scott
- 21 November, 2008 08:20
- Comments
Innovation is mandatory in today's ultracompetitive corporate landscape, especially for a tech giant like Microsoft. As CIO of Microsoft, Tony Scott must create a culture that encourages experimentation and innovation while simultaneously creating clear guidelines about which creative ideas are worth pursuing. That the company is filled with talented technology professionals makes balancing those two forces-freedom and control-even more difficult. Brian Carlson sat down with Scott to hear how the CIO tackles such challenges, whether Microsoft uses open-source tools, and why he advocates for internal customers.
Do you see many rogue IT projects inside your company, and what's your strategy as CIO for dealing with them?
The subject of rogue IT or shadow IT is on every CIO's mind, and it's certainly been one of the fun things at Microsoft. We have a lot of people who have the capability to develop, whether that's their official role or not. For me the issue is creating an environment where you encourage and allow for innovation, but then quickly figure out which parts of that innovation matter and what doesn't. And so at Microsoft we have a fairly healthy methodology for doing that. We encourage innovation. But we quickly settle on those things that are going to make a difference and weed out those things that are not going to make a difference. So I don't think it's a bad thing. I think people using our tools and using our technology to solve business problems is a good thing. And then it's just a question in our case of making sure that you fully utilize those things that make a big difference and quickly get rid of those things that are just chatter or noise or not effective.
Do you use open-source tools in Microsoft IT?
I'd say it's not our predominant tendency to use open-source tools. However, where we do, it's probably in the areas that you might suspect. In test automation there's a number of great tools, vulnerability testing, also when we test for sensitive information around the company, so tools like Spider and so on are examples of that. And we certainly use them because we want to know what might be used either with us or against us from that perspective.
How do you encourage your large IT organization to innovate?
Innovation is probably one of the most interesting subjects in IT today. Certainly the demand on most IT organizations is to do more with less, do more with flat budgets, and so innovation becomes the best source for figuring out ways to accomplish that mission. In Microsoft, what we try to do is foster an environment that encourages innovation and then quickly sorts out those things that are truly innovative versus just different. I make that distinction because in an inventive world and a creative environment, often different is seen as better, and that's not necessarily the case. And so our test is, does it really matter? Can it move the needle? Can this make a 30, 40, 50 percent difference in productivity or 100 percent or 500 percent? That's kind of the barometer of what matters. If it's a 5 percent improvement or a 2 percent improvement, generally it's not that interesting. And so I think innovation is the engine that allows you to get some of these quantum leaps in terms of productivity or a new way of doing things that ultimately leads to greater value for our customers or even our internal parts of our organization.
Join the CIO Australia group on LinkedIn. The group is open to CIOs, IT Directors, COOs, CTOs and senior IT managers.
- Bookmark this page
- Share this article
- Got more on this story? Email CIO
- Follow CIO on twitter
- Setting a strategy for secure mobile printing
- Oracle Business Intelligence and Data Warehousing From Storage to Scorecard
- Forrester Research - Exploring the Benefits of End-to-End Convergence of Data Center Networks
- Oracle Exadata: Extreme Performance Lowest Cost
- Leveraging the Service Catalog to Scale Your MSP Business
-
China's Alibaba sees big growth with AliExpress site
-
Pfizer's Future Depends on IT Transformation
-
10 Tips for Dealing with a Bully Boss
-
Social networking security in the workplace
-
Facebook stock slumps for third day
-
Optimizing Data Quality in the Enterprise - How to Tackle Your Bad Information
Data quality – the measure of data accuracy, completeness, and consistency across a business – has become the core focus of information management efforts among many of today’s organizations. Problems with data quality continue to plague corporations of all types and sizes. In this paper, we will discuss some techniques companies can implement to enhance data quality across the entire enterprise. We will also highlight data quality management solutions, which provide businesses with the ability to effectively and economically enhance the correctness, completeness, and consistency of information in each and every system within their technology infrastructure. -
Oracle SOA Suite – Oracle BPEL Process Manager
Changing markets, increasing competitive pressures and evolving customer needs are placing greater pressure on IT to deliver greater flexibility and speed. In response to these challenges, leading companies are adopting Service-Oriented Architecture (SOA) as a means of delivering on these requirements by overcoming the complexity of their application and IT environments. Read on. -
Guidance for Calculation of Efficiency (PUE) in Data Centers
The benefits of determining data center infrastructure efficiency as part of an effective energy management plan are widely recognised. The standard metrics of Power Usage Effectiveness (PUE) and its reciprocal Data Center Infrastructure Efficiency1 (DCIE) have emerged as recognised standards. This paper defines a standard approach to collecting data from data centers and showing how to use it to calculate PUE, with a focus on what to do with data that is confusing or incomplete.
-
Linux Network Servers (Craig Hunt Linux Library)
-
Balanced Scorecards & Operational Dashboards with Microsoft Excel
-
Object-oriented I/O Using C++ Iostreams
-
Mobile Python - Rapid Prototyping of Applications on the Mobile Platform
-
Test ISBN for Kathy Collins Only
-
Access 2002 Desktop Developer's Handbook (Includes CD-ROM)
-
Local Area Networks
-
Hacking Windows XP
-
Red Hat Linux 9 Bible








Comments
Post new comment